A Kisumu based football analyst wants the Independent Electoral and Boundaries Commission (IEBC) Chairman Wafula Chebukati to deny former Harambee Stars and Inter Milan midfielder Macdonald Mariga a chance to vie for the Kibra Parliament seat on the ruling Jubilee Party’s ticket.

Dennis Mogendi, popularly known as Mosh Junior said Mariga should be stopped from vying for the seat because ‘it was not his decision to vie’ in the first place.

“I hope Mariga is stopped from contesting for the seat because I believe it was not his decision to vie. I feel somebody is pushing him,” he said in an exclusive interview on Saturday. The analyst claimed he sees Deputy President William Ruto’s hand in Mariga’s running.

“By joining politics, Mariga has made one of the worst mistakes of his life. I can see Deputy President William Ruto’s hand in his bid. They (Ruto and Mariga) are very good friends,” he said.

Shortly after being handed Jubilee’s ticket, Mariga got a blow after IEBC disqualified him from the race because his details were missing from the voter’s register. He appealed the decision. 

A final decision on his candidature is expected to be made by the Wafula Chebukati led commission on Monday, September 16.

The Kibra Parliamentary seat fell vacant following the death of former MP, Ken Okoth in July. The by-election to elect a new MP will be conducted on November 07.
